The problem is "loud" is totally subjective. I've heard people call the Perrin Resonated 2.5" loud, but to me it was as loud as stock WITH Catless UEL headers.

When i had the WORKS ABM muffler delete, it was definitely loud. Significantly louder than stock. It was also my first ever aftermarket exhaust so i had no idea what i was getting into.

The best way i can describe it, is if its like having a leafblower right outside your window. Its loud. but not quite as loud as if you were next to it. But loud enough that its going to wake you up and bother you while you trying to sleep.

I agree, definitely subjective. I'm looking for that 'I'm too old to have a loud exhaust' opinion. My current axle-back exhaust, top speed pro 1, is perfect in the sound department but the tips are too big for my taste and the tips are not aligned perfectly in the bumper cutouts. Trying to decide on going with the Works, or asking my buddy that welds to weld on smaller and better aligned tips.

You cant really go wrong with the WORKS ABM imo. I only got rid of it because i had the muffler delete and that was too loud for me. I'm not sure how loud the Speed Pro 1 is, but the ABM should be roughly 92-93db at WOT and close to stock at idle.

oso_25 03-15-2018 07:23 PM

I have the WORKS axelback with a Gruppe UEL header and I think it is a great sounding combo. Yea the inside of the car is a bit louder than stock but you get used to it. Idk why but I feel like I can control the sound of the loudness based on how you drive. Also I get a loud cold start noise but once the car is completely warmed up it goes away and sounds fine.
